This is what you will be doing

Reporting to the Sales Director, this is a leadership role where you will be managing a small team with responsibility for coaching, developing, supporting and motivating direct reports to ensure business targets are met.

In this role, in addition to managing the team, you will have direct account responsibility.

Your focus will be to build effective customer strategies and relationships with all designated accounts, to achieve and exceed budgeted sales and margin targets. Your key accountabilities will be:

  • Developing, communicating and delivering  medium & long term strategies & short term (1 year) business plans for designated accounts to achieve maximum sales and profit growth whilst ensuring customer strategies are achieved
  • Establishing close business relationships with all key customer personnel in assigned accounts, ensuring the correct frequency of contact, so that Lantmännen Unibake in the UK is involved in all business development opportunities
  • Negotiating commercial agreements
  • Facilitating the interaction between customers' key personnel and relevant colleagues
  • Working closely with all accounts to highlight NPD opportunities, develop products in conjunction with the product category strategy so that customer needs are met and sales targets are achieved
  • Continually monitoring and analysing the relevant markets in order to become and remain aware of competitor activity
  • Coaching and mentoring direct reports

Always hungry – a never-ending appetite for more 

We built our company on a culture of entrepreneurship. Originally, Lantmännen Unibake grew through the acquisition of bakeries that were strong within their local markets. We added structure and created the foundation for the strength and scope of Lantmännen Unibake today.  

We call it “One Unibake”. We believe it unlocks the additional potential of our subsidiaries by organizing core processes and operations in a structured setup.  

We keep customer proximity, agility and accountability on a local level and add the strength of a global organization – all encompassed in our values. 

We focus equally on growth through acquisitions and organic growth, consolidation and the creation of a highly integrated group structure.
